New CMS Training Requirements Starting in 2016, all Medicare Advantage organizations and Prescription Drug Plan sponsors, like Health Alliance Medicare, will be required to provide general compliance and fraud, waste, and abuse (FWA) training for all employees of their organization and for the first-tier, downstream, and related entities (FDRs) they partner or contract with to provide benefits or services.
